As the world's leader in digital payments technology, Visa's mission is to connect the world through the most creative, reliable and secure payment network - enabling individuals, businesses, and economies to thrive. Our advanced global processing network, VisaNet, provides secure and reliable payments around the world, and is capable of handling more than 65,000 transaction messages a second. Job Description

It is to oversee the Philippines payroll functions and work closely with the Controller and HR Team to maintained compliance, integrity, accuracy at all times. 

We are looking for a candidate that has strong leadership and coaching to the payroll processing team. Successful leadership ensure the fully execute the task promptly with no errors.

Responsibilities:

  • It is to review the accuracy of time-sheet (including signed off by employees and line manager) through mailboxes and ADP e-time systems. 
  • Quick follow through on missing time-sheets in resolving all dispute items with the payroll team within 48 hours. 
  • Administer payroll calendars and communication to employees, HR and Controllership team. 
  • To manage the team annual leave and sick leave and request for overtime.
  • Ensure documentation and reconciliation for Pasay and Makati on a bi-weekly and monthly basis.
  • To ensure answering queries from the HR mailbox and closing HR tickets within a stipulated timeline. 
  • To be the main focal point for all payroll service providers and work closely with the Director in the region and Head of Global Payroll. 
  • Ensure to meet payroll and government agency payment timelines. 
  • A strong experience in preparing annual audit (internal, external, SOX, government, tax) on Pasay and Makati payroll matter. 
  • To assist in the preparation of audit schedules for payroll.

 

Qualifications

  • At least 7 years of relevant experience in end to end payroll operation/administration in the Philippines with a Degree in Human Resource or Finance. 
  • Meticulous with strong analytical, organization and planning skills. 
  • Strong knowledge of Philippines payroll best practices, government and tax regulation. 
  •  Proficiency in Workday and ADP e-time will be an added advantages.
